The SF71053M2 10-Port managed industrial switch features 8 fast Ethernet ports with Auto-Negotiate and Auto-MDI/MDI-X capabilities, and two 100Mbps ST fiber connector ports that support multimode fiber optics.
This ST fiber switch is energy-efficient with a power consumption of 9 watts at full load. It supports DIN rail installation options for easy deployment. The switch also supports 802.3x flow control for full duplex and backpressure flow control for half-duplex operation, ensuring seamless data transmission and minimizing congestion.
Network Ports
8-10/100 Copper Ports (RJ-45) with Auto-Negotiate, Auto-MDI/MDI-X 2-100Mbps Multimode Fiber Ports with ST connectors
Switching Architecture
Store-and-Forward
Switching Capacity
26Gbps (non-blocking)
MAC Address Table
8K
Maximum Frame Size
9.6K Bytes (Jumbo Frames)
Flow Control
Back pressure (Half-Duplex) IEEE 802.3x Pause Frame (Full-Duplex)
LED Indication
Power: On – Green Copper Ports: Link/Activity – Amber
Management Interface
Console CLI Telnet Web – SSH/SSL, SNMP v1, v2c, v3c
Port Configuration
Enable / Disable Auto-Negotiation Full and Half Duplex mode selection Flow control
Port Mirroring
Tx/Rx: Many-to-1 monitoring
Bandwidth Control
Ingress / Egress rate control
VLAN
IEEE 802.1q tag-based VLAN Up to 256 VLAN groups 4094 VLAN IDs Port-Based VLAN MAC-based VLAN Protocol-based VLAN MVR (Multiple VLAN Registration) Q-in-Q Tunneling
Link Aggregation
IEEE 802.3ad LACP / Static Trunk Up to 5 groups
Quality of Service (Qos)
8 priority queues Traffic classification: IEEE 802.1p, IP DSCP
Multicasting / IGMP
IGMP / MLD Snooping (v1, v2, v3) with Query Support
Access Control List
IP-based ACL / MAC-based ACL 256 entries
SNMP MIBs
RFC-1213 MIB-II RFC-2819 RMON MIB (Group 1, 2, 3, 9)
Power Consumption
9 Watts (Full Load)
DC Power Input Voltage
Dual 9 ~ 52VDC Auto-Sensing
Dimensions
6.14 x 4.52 x 2.36 inches (156 x 114.8 x 60 mm)
Case
IP44 Metal
Mounting
DIN Rail
MTBF
>100,000 hours
Environment
Operating Temperature: -20°C ~ +70°C Storage Temperature: -20°C ~ +85°C Relative Humidity: 5% to 95% non-condensing
